Transaction efe2f2642af322612f8d755e236d5f5920d4a26f46da9b969e96b6661899982f
1 Input
1 Output
-
efe2f2642af322612f8d755e236d5f5920d4a26f46da9b969e96b6661899982f:0
- value
- 19182300
- script pubkey
- OP_0 OP_PUSHBYTES_20 8df7bd2c46261ce63597275dd16c38b6a5bdf26c
- address
- bc1q3hmm6tzxycwwvdvhyawazmpck6jmmunvlg3j9l